MITCalc is a engineering, industrial, and technical calculator for the day-to-day needs. MITCalc is a multi-language mechanical and technical calculation package. It includes solutions for gear, belt and chain drives, bearings, springs, bearings, beam, shaft, bolt connection, shaft connection, tolerances and many other mechanical parts. The calculations are compatible with most types of 2D and 3D CAD systems (AutoCAD®, AutoCAD LT®, IntelliCAD®, Ashlar Graphite®, TurboCAD®, Autodesk Inventor®, SolidWorks®, Solid Edge®, Pro/ENGINEER®...) , support both Imperial and Metric units, and are processed according to ANSI, ISO, DIN, BS, Japanese and other common standards.
It will reliably, precisely, and most of all quickly guide you through the design of components, the solution of a technical problem, or a calculation of an engineering point without any significant need for expert knowledge.
MITCalc contains both design and check calculations of many common tasks, such as: spur gear, bevel gear, timing belt, v-belt and chain drives, bearings, springs, beam, buckling, shaft, bolt connection, shaft connection, force couplings of shafts, pins, tolerances, tolerance analysis, technical formulas and many others. You also have available many material, comparison, and decision tables, including a system for the administration of resolved tasks.

MITCalc is an open system designed in Microsoft Excel to which you can make further modifications or user extensions without any programming skills.
You don’t have to learn MITCalc because you already know how to use it. The straightforward and fully comprehensive user interface with complex on-line help and the “expert notes” system will allow you to be more productive in just a few minutes.
